在WordPress多語言插件市場,Polylang與WPML長期占據主導地位。前者以開源輕量著稱,后者憑商業化成熟度立足,兩者不存在絕對的優劣之分。選擇的關鍵在于網站規模、功能需求、技術儲備和預算成本。本文將從底層架構到實際應用進行全方位拆解,為不同場景的用戶提供決策依據。?
一、核心架構:輕量集成vs深度獨立?
插件的底層設計直接決定穩定性和擴展性,這是兩者差異的根源:?
WPML的獨立架構:作為擁有十年迭代歷史的商業化產品,WPML采用獨立語言表存儲不同語言內容,每種語言版本擁有完整的數據庫結構支撐。這種設計的優勢在于支持深度翻譯,包括短代碼、自定義字段、動態內容等復雜元素,即使是主題和插件的非標準文本也能精準識別。但代價是數據庫查詢量較大,單頁面SQL查詢平均增加18-25次。?
Polylang的輕量架構:走開源路線的Polylang遵循“原生集成”理念,所有語言內容共享同一套數據庫結構,僅通過語言標簽區分。這種設計對服務器資源消耗極低,查詢量僅增加8-12次,加載速度更優。但缺點是依賴主題和插件對Polylang API的支持,處理Elementor等可視化編輯器的動態內容時容易受限。?
二、功能特性:全面專業vs精簡實用?
1.基礎翻譯功能?
WPML:支持文章、頁面、分類、菜單、小工具、主題字符串等全場景翻譯,甚至能處理WooCommerce的產品屬性、購物車文本、郵件模板等電商核心元素(需附加模塊)。其“復制到其他語言”功能可一鍵同步內容結構,減少重復編輯工作。?
Polylang:免費版已覆蓋文章、頁面、分類等基礎翻譯需求,Pro版擴展支持自定義字段和WooCommerce集成。但內容同步需安裝“Sync Content”擴展,且僅支持文本字段,媒體文件需手動關聯。?
2.語言切換體驗?
WPML:提供小工具、短代碼、模板調用、導航菜單嵌入四種方式,支持AJAX平滑切換(無整頁刷新),可自定義切換器樣式(國旗、語言代碼、名稱),甚至能設置不同語言的跳轉規則。?
Polylang:支持小工具和短代碼調用,但導航菜單集成需額外CSS定制才能達到WPML的視覺效果。默認URL為參數模式(?lang=zh),需手動配置為目錄或子域名模式,且子域名部署需額外處理DNS和SSL證書。?
3.翻譯管理效率?
WPML:內置翻譯管理系統(TMS),支持多人協作翻譯、翻譯進度追蹤,可對接專業翻譯機構,AI翻譯(PTC系統)能基于上下文保持術語一致性,提供60天百萬字退款保障。?
Polylang:以手動翻譯為主,Pro版支持DeepL等機器翻譯集成,操作流程貼合WordPress原生邏輯,學習成本低,但缺乏團隊協作和進度管理功能。?
三、兼容性與穩定性:生態成熟vs原生適配?
1.主題與插件兼容?
實測數據顯示,兩者在主流主題和插件上的兼容性存在明顯差異:
| 工具 / 插件 | WPML 兼容性 | Polylang 兼容性 | 備注 |
| Astra/OceanWP | 完全兼容 | 完全兼容(需 3.0 + 版) | 官方明確聲明支持 |
| Flatsome | 完全兼容(需 UX 支持) | 部分兼容(無法翻譯可視化內容) | 可視化編輯器支持不足 |
| Elementor | 完全兼容 | 需 Pro 版 + 專用擴展 | 免費版不支持 Elementor 翻譯 |
| WooCommerce | 完全兼容(需模塊) | 基本兼容 | 支付流程和郵件翻譯支持有限 |
WPML通過自動化測試確保與65+語言、數千款主題插件的兼容性,用戶基數超600萬,穩定性經過長期驗證;Polylang因架構依賴原生功能,在遵循WordPress編碼規范的主題上表現穩定,但對非標準開發的插件適配較差。?
2.技術支持?
WPML:商業版提供1年premium支持,響應速度快,文檔詳盡,還提供30天無條件退款保障。用戶反饋其技術支持能快速解決復雜的兼容性問題。?
Polylang:免費版僅提供社區支持,Pro版支持郵件咨詢,響應周期較長,但問題解決率尚可,適合技術能力較強的用戶。?
四、性能與SEO:輕量高效vs全面優化?
1.網站性能影響?
WPML:未優化時,首頁加載時間平均增加0.7秒(從1.2s到1.9s),需通過對象緩存(Redis)、緩存插件(WP Rocket)禁用冗余模塊等方式優化,優化后可回落至1.4s內。?
Polylang:輕量架構使其加載時間增加不超過0.3秒,無需復雜優化即可保持良好性能,更適合服務器配置有限的中小型站點。?
2.多語言SEO支持?
WPML:自動生成規范的hreflang標簽,支持語言專屬SEO元信息(標題、關鍵詞、描述),可生成多語言站點地圖并自動提交至搜索引擎,URL結構完全可自定義,對SEO友好度極高。?
Polylang:同樣支持hreflang標簽和站點地圖,但免費版缺乏語言專屬SEO設置,需依賴Rank Math等SEO插件補充,URL結構優化需手動操作,易因配置不當影響收錄。?
五、價格成本:開源免費vs商業付費?
WPML:無免費版,基礎版(含核心翻譯功能)約99美元/年,電商版(含WooCommerce模塊)約199美元/年,多站點授權更貴,但提供50%續期折扣。?
Polylang:核心功能免費,Pro版99歐元/年,WooCommerce擴展99歐元/年,商業套餐(含所有擴展)139歐元/年,多站點授權可選,成本僅為WPML的1/2左右。?
六、適用場景與決策建議?
選擇WPML的三大場景:?
企業級網站/電商平臺:需深度翻譯、多團隊協作、穩定技術支持,尤其是WooCommerce電商站點,WPML的完整電商翻譯解決方案不可替代。?
復雜內容站點:使用Elementor等可視化編輯器、自定義字段較多,或需處理動態內容(如會員系統、表單)的站點。?
SEO驅動型站點:重視國際搜索引擎排名,需要精細化URL結構和hreflang標簽管理的跨境業務站點。?
選擇Polylang的三大場景:?
中小型站點/個人博客:內容結構簡單,僅需基礎翻譯功能,預算有限或追求輕量化體驗。?
技術自主型用戶:具備一定CSS/服務器配置能力,可自行解決URL優化、兼容性適配等問題。?
多語言入門需求:首次搭建多語言站點,希望以低成本測試市場反應,后續可根據需求升級至Pro版。?
適配需求才是核心?
Polylang以“開源免費+輕量高效”成為中小型站點的性價比之選,其原生集成設計確保了基礎場景的穩定性;WPML則憑借“功能全面+生態成熟+專業支持”,成為企業級和復雜站點的首選,尤其在電商和SEO需求上優勢顯著。?
選擇時無需糾結“哪個更好”,而應聚焦“哪個更適配”:若預算有限、需求簡單,Polylang免費版即可滿足;若業務依賴多語言轉化、需要長期穩定支持,WPML的付費投入能顯著降低技術風險。無論選擇哪款,都需注意正確配置URL結構和hreflang標簽,避免因技術細節影響全球流量獲取。